I was looking on ArtUK for potential cover art and found this Kandinsky listed as CC0. The linked museum though seemed to have fairly strict copyright and redistribution rules though. I ended up pinging ArtUK’s Rights contact to see what was going on, and they pointed me at the new Museum Wales images site that has the same CC0 designation: https://images.museumwales.ac.uk/view-item?i=167376.
I’ve had a quick poke around in https://images.museumwales.ac.uk/ and it seems like all the art I can find is CC0 licensed; some of the photos are CC-by-SA 4.0 though. Shall we add this as a potential source_
